How to check deposit records in Bitpie?

Next, let's discuss the specific steps to view the recharge records in Bitpie. This process is relatively straightforward, and users only need to follow the following steps. However, for a better understanding, we will provide a more detailed explanation of the information.

  • Log in to Bitpie account
  • First, users need to open the Bitpie app or visit the official Bitpie website and enter their corresponding email address and password. Once logged in, users will be taken to their account interface where they can view their current assets and transaction information.

  • Enter the "Asset Management" interface
  • In the main interface of Bitpie, users will see multiple options including Assets, Market, Trade, and Settings. Selecting the "Assets" option allows users to view their digital asset status, including current balance, transaction history, and deposit information.

  • Find recharge records
  • After entering the asset page, users need to select the "Deposit" or "Transaction History" option. In this interface, all deposit records will be listed in chronological order. Generally, deposit records include the following information:

  • 2. Recharge Processing TimeRecord the specific date and time of your recharge.
  • Top-up AmountDisplay the specific amount and currency of the user's recharge.
  • Top-up addressDisplay the address used for recharging to facilitate identification.
  • Transaction StatusIndicate whether the recharge is successfully completed.
  • Users can click on each record to view more detailed transaction information, including the transaction hash, and more.

  • Export or screenshot to save the records.
  • If users need to save recharge records, for example for financial statements or audits, they can choose to export or take a screenshot of the corresponding records. Bitpie provides an export function, allowing users to export records as CSV files for easy future reference and management.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    While reviewing the recharge records, there are inevitably some questions. Here are some common questions and answers to help users dispel doubts and better use Bitpie.

  • When the payment is still processing, the recharge record may not be displayed.
  • Recharge records may not be displayed for several reasons. First, the recharge may not have been successful, possibly due to network issues or entering the wrong address. Second, recharges require a certain confirmation time, and if the transaction has not reached enough confirmations, it may still be in a pending state. Users should be patient and check the transaction status.

  • How to handle an incorrect recharge address?
  • If funds are accidentally recharged to the wrong address, it is usually not possible to fix it on your own. Users should immediately contact the customer service team of Bitpie, explain the situation, and request assistance. Although the outcome may not necessarily recover the losses, taking action as soon as possible is always more likely to find a solution.

  • How can I ensure the security of my recharge records?
  • Users should regularly change their account passwords and enable security features such as two-factor authentication. In addition, be mindful to avoid logging into accounts in insecure environments, and ensure the security of your devices and network connections to protect the safety of your account.

  • Is it possible to view the complete history of all recharges?
  • Yes, users can view all their historical recharge records in their Bitpie account. These records are continuously saved and will be retained and available for viewing as long as the user's account is in normal status.

  • Do I need to pay a fee to view the recharge records in Bitpie?
  • During the process of querying recharge records, users do not need to pay any handling fees. All query operations are free, and users can freely view their recharge records. Only when conducting actual recharge and withdrawal operations, there may be fees such as network miner fees.
